The Ultimate Win!

It was the quick errand that Shelley Suttles will never forget.

The Bridgeport man says he was running errands and needed to pick up a few items when he decided to buy an Ultimate 7s scratch game ticket at checkout. 

It turned out to be a $1 million winner. 

“I almost passed out,” Suttles said after discovering his prize. “I scratched off the box and saw a million dollars. I’ve never seen a million dollars on a ticket before. I picked up the phone and told my sister, and she started screaming. She couldn’t believe it either.” 

Suttles says he’s a regular CT Lottery player and enjoys the experience of playing. 

The winning ticket was purchased at Grand Package Store on Main St. in Bridgeport. For selling the ticket, Grand Package Store will receive a $10,000 bonus — one of the many benefits of being a CT Lottery retail partner. 

Suttles says he plans to use the money to pay off bills and donate to his church.

He’s also no stranger to winning…over the summer, Shelley won $100,000 playing Cash5.

NOTICE: Beginning October 1, 2025, the CT Lottery will no longer publish winners’ names without their written consent in accordance with Sec. 3(d) of Public Act 25-112.

The winning names, stories and photos on this website are just a small number of the thousands who claim prizes. The fact is, people win every day with the CT Lottery! Below is a list of recently claimed prizes of $10,000 or more. Please Note: When a winning scratch ticket is validated through a Lottery Retailer's terminal, the remaining number of unclaimed prizes for that prize level is automatically updated reflecting one less prize. Until the individual or group presents their winning ticket for claim at CT Lottery Headquarters, the identity of a winner is unknown.
